The elegant, fleshy and glossy arching leaves at the base add a final touch to this otherworldly floral display. Did you know that orchids have the largest color range of any flower? And in fact, you can even find convincingly black ones, like ‘Stealth’ slipper orchid. It is a recent hybrid by Krull-Smith from Orchid Zone between Paphilopedilum ‘Hsinying Maru’ and Paphilopedilum rhothschidlianum, introduced in 2007.
